The rock lateral constraint expansion testing instrument features a direct-reading dial gauge structure, suitable for testing the axial displacement changes under lateral constraint conditions in various rock expansion tests. It is equipped with a permeable plate, dial gauge, and other testing devices.
The rock free expansion rate testing instrument is suitable for rocks that are not easily disintegrated when encountering water. This testing instrument features a digital readout dial gauge layout, applicable for various rock expansion tests in an unconfined environment, allowing for testing of displacement changes in all directions. It is equipped with a permeable plate, dial gauge, and other testing devices.
The rock expansion pressure testing instrument features a digital display and manually rotates the screw to apply pressure. It is suitable for expansion pressure tests under constant volume conditions in various types of rock expansion tests, and is equipped with a permeable plate, a dial gauge, and other testing devices.

The rock direct shear apparatus is developed according to the national industry standards (SLT264-2020) "Test Procedures for Rocks in Water Conservancy and Hydropower Engineering" and (JTG E41-2005) "Test Procedures for Rocks in Highway Engineering." This instrument uses a flat pushing method and is mainly suitable for direct shear tests of rock blocks, structural surfaces (such as joint surfaces, layer surfaces, fissure surfaces, etc.), and the contact surfaces (bonding surfaces) between concrete (or mortar) and rock, as well as shear strength tests of the bonding surfaces between concrete and other materials or overall shear strength tests. The machine has a simple structure, is lightweight, intuitive, easy to maintain, can be used in the field, and provides digital display of test data that is accurate and reliable.

The point load strength test is an indicator for rock materials, which can determine the point load strength of the sample as well as the anisotropy of the strength index, that is, the ratio of the maximum to the minimum values of different point load strengths.
The rock disintegration resistance testing instrument is mainly used to determine the durable disintegration index of rocks. It can test the durability of rocks against disintegration after being affected by climatic conditions, specifically due to the alternation of dry and wet conditions. This device features a motor fixed to the base plate that rotates two drum-shaped sample boxes at a speed of 20 revolutions per minute. The drum-shaped sample boxes are mounted on bearings coated with lubricating oil, allowing them to rotate without resistance. The drum-shaped sample boxes are made of corrosion-resistant materials and are equipped with two water tanks. It is widely applicable in universities, research institutes, testing centers, etc., for determining clay-type rocks and weathered rocks.
Applicable to coal and rock that can be made into standard specimens. A radial compressive line load is applied to solid cylindrical specimens until failure, to determine the maximum tensile stress of the specimens.
The rock boiling water bath is produced according to the rock saturation water absorption boiling regulations in the highway engineering rock testing specifications (JTGE41-2005) and the hydropower engineering rock testing specifications (DLT-2368-2015).
